In today’s world, the increasing use of cars has led to a multitude of negative impacts on the environment and people’s health. It is evident that this trend is contributing to global warming and causing other undesirable effects on our well-being. Therefore, it is crucial to consider effective measures to discourage people from using their cars excessively.

One possible solution is to improve and expand public transportation systems. By investing in efficient and affordable public transportation, individuals will have a viable alternative to using their cars. This can be achieved by increasing the frequency of buses and trains, extending the coverage of routes, and implementing measures to make public transportation more accessible to all members of the community. Additionally, incentives such as reduced fares and dedicated lanes for public transport can further encourage people to opt for this mode of transportation.

Furthermore, promoting the use of alternative modes of transportation, such as cycling and walking, can also help reduce car use. Creating more bike lanes and pedestrian-friendly pathways can make these options more appealing and safer for individuals. Additionally, implementing policies that support and incentivize carpooling and ride-sharing can help decrease the number of cars on the road.

Another approach to discouraging car use is to implement measures that make driving less convenient and more costly. This can be achieved through the introduction of congestion charges in urban areas, increasing parking fees, and implementing stricter emissions regulations. By making driving less attractive and more expensive, individuals may be more inclined to seek alternative modes of transportation.

In conclusion, the detrimental effects of increasing car use on the environment and public health necessitate the implementation of measures to discourage its excessive use. By improving public transportation, promoting alternative modes of transportation, and implementing policies to make driving less convenient and more costly, we can work towards reducing the reliance on cars and mitigating their negative impacts. It is essential for governments and communities to come together to address this issue and create a more sustainable and healthier environment for all.
